Today’s Promise

Great is Your Faithfulness

Lamentations 3:23

The Lord’s lovingkindnesses indeed never cease, for His compassions never fail. They are new every morning; Great is Your faithfulness.


Today’s promise was the basis of one of the greatest hymns of the faith.

Every morning God gives us a new start. Each day represents a new beginning. We can start anew in our walk with God and in receiving His love and grace.

This promise comes during a difficult time in the life of Jeremiah and the people of God. After a long period of lament, Jeremiah remembers the faithfulness of God.

The word “lovingkindness” used in this promise means God’s commitment love toward us.

Many of us know this promise from the hymn, “Great is Thy Faithfulness.”

It was written by a Methodist minister named Thomas Chrisholm almost 100 years ago. 

In a letter written late in his life, he wrote, “I must not fail to record here the unfailing faithfulness of a covenant-keeping God and that He has given me many wonderful displays of His providing care, for which I am filled with astonishing gratefulness.”

All of us could join Thomas in confessing how good and faithful God has been to us.

Great is Thy Faithfulness, Great is Thy Faithfulness.
Morning by morning new mercies I see.
All I have needed Thy hand hath provided.
Great is thy Faithfulness, Lord unto me.
